About

Gym America Summer Camps offers gymnastics along with Preschool Playtime, instructional Open Gym, and camp enrichment activities. Campers take part in activities on gymnastics equipment and in supervised play and open gym time. The program offers half-day camps as well as full-day camps every week during summer.

• Ages: 3–12 years old
• Schedule: Half-day and full-day camp options offered weekly during summer

Gym America Summer Camps takes place in a state-of-the-art gymnastics facility. Camps are open to school-age children and preschoolers, and space is limited. Preschool Playtime is staff supervised playtime for children ages 18 months to 4 years old, and instructional Open Gym is a staff supervised, hour-long open gym for children ages 5 to 10 years old. During instructional Open Gym, students are encouraged to work on perfecting skills they have been taught in class, jump on the trampolines, and explore gymnastics.

Gym America was established in 1979 by Claudia and Ed Kretschmer and has been in business for over 40 years, with over 43 years of providing gymnastics instruction. The leadership team includes owners and directors Claudia Kretschmer and Ed Kretschmer, along with program and team directors such as Heather Helms, Kurtis Rosen, Kayla Mangas, Sarah Strzalkowski, Jamie Krol, Shauna MacMillian, Kim Tanana, Patty Sacco, and others in instructional, preschool, office, and team roles. Gym America coaches Compulsory, Xcel, and Optional levels and has had National level athletes for over 30 years, has competed at USA Championships, and has produced over 38 college athletes, including many collegiate team captains and scholar athletes.
